# Pixelforge CLI — Environments

Pixelforge, our batch image-resizing CLI maintained by the Harwood tooling group, runs against three environments: local, staging, and production. Each environment differs in worker concurrency, output bucket, and maximum source dimensions, so please verify which profile is active before running large jobs. For clarity, the production profile currently ships with the values listed below.

config for bahof-tagep:
kelael:
  pin: 3701
  tenant: fraius
  seal: seal_566287a7
  metrics_host: metrics.kelael.ferradyn.local
  standby_team: sormir
  escalation: juldor-oliir
  nonce: 530523

Ticket: Invoicekit PDF renderer broken on staging again. Invoices come out with the fallback font and no company branding, which means the renderer can't reach the asset vault and is silently degrading instead of failing — lovely. Checked the staging box: someone rotated the vault credential last week but never updated the renderer's env file, so it's still holding the old one. Fix is quick. SSH to the staging renderer host, open its env file, and replace the stale entry with the current line:

vault entry, hawip-bahif: COURIER_KEY20=0cc4378a8ab04bccc3fd

14:22 — Archival job for the cold storage buckets (Glacierline tier) was paused after the manifest checksum mismatch was detected. The release manager was notified and the rollback candidate was identified from the provenance log. No customer data was affected; the suspect artifact corresponds to the trace token below.

session token of kafop-hawep = htk21_413e49a27bdeacde54774